Using Mini-Tumors to Develop Treatments


Scientists and doctors at Wake Forest University in Virginia are exploring the possibility of personalized mesothelioma treatments in their lab. Researchers are studying treatments that they perform on biopsies of 3D mini-mesothelioma tumors from patients.
